Students need access to high-interest, culturally relevant books. Students face so many challenges in their preteen years. Social issue book clubs give students a chance to read and discuss books about kids their age, who are experiencing some of the same problems they face. Students are able to relate to the characters they read about and learn how to navigate these challenges the way the characters in their stories did. Book clubs give students a forum for discussing and relating to these characters. Let's get great books in the hands of students!
